635 N.W.2d 319

P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F MICHIGAN, Plaintiff-Appellee, v. ALEX GEORGE, Defendant-Appellant.

No. 118451.Supreme Court of Michigan.
October 29, 2001.

COA: 230599, Wayne CC: 99-500018

36th DC: 98-068767

By order of February 26, 2001, the application for leave to appeal was held in abeyance pending the decision in People v Thousand, (Docket No. 116967). On order of the Court, the decision having been issued on July 27, 2001, 465 Mich. 149; 631 N.W.2d 694 (2001), the application is again considered, and it is DENIED, because we are not persuaded that the questions presented should be reviewed by this Court.
